Output 6562ea8a4e15949d0a6f640ddc1627ccedc81285a4d6e23d7271bf62fbba4e92:0

value
276133
script pubkey
OP_0 OP_PUSHBYTES_20 cc986177c5d338938ab9eaefaa45112bc1b4a35a
address
bc1qejvxza796vuf8z4eath653g390qmfg6626zwx6
transaction
6562ea8a4e15949d0a6f640ddc1627ccedc81285a4d6e23d7271bf62fbba4e92
confirmations
597
spent
true